Lorac Front of the Line Pro Eyeliner

Next to red lipstick, cat eyeliner is probably my favorite way to make a statement with makeup. And like red lipstick, its always a classic, but you really have to own it to pull it off. I especially like it this summer with a bare face – maybe with a little concealer and a cream highlighter, or a shimmery bronzer to give the skin a glow. I even like the way it looks without mascara. Just a bold line for a really clean, daring look. Its sexy and glamorous, but it still says,”I’ve got better things to do than stand in front of the mirror for hours”.

Lorac’s Front of the Line Pro eyeliner surprised me with its ease of application. Even for a professional, getting a perfect cat eye is a little challenging, but this really was a cinch. Its also really, really black, and once its on, it stays there until you decide to take it off. Bummer, therefore, that it only comes in two colors, black and brown. Hello? I’d love to see it in a vibrant sapphire blue and maybe a deep violet or a shimmery graphite. All products, including this one, should be spot tested for sensitivities. Available on the Lorac website, and at Sephora. $22.

Good, Inexpensive Lipstick


People are always asking me to recommend drugstore brands that perform well. I know we all want a bargain, but other than mascara, I have not been impressed with the general quality of drugstore cosmetics. There was an exception. The Swedish brand Isadora was sold at Walgreens once upon a time, albeit at a price point a little higher than the other brands, but the quality and color choices were worth seeking out. Alas, I have not been able to find it for years. Having said that, I recently went into Sephora to find a specific color requested by a client for her latest resort collection, and I stumbled upon the Sephora Collection lipstick line. Its a few more dollars than what you’ll find at your local pharmacy, but the quality surprised me. The texture of the cream lipsticks is gorgeous, and they are right on trend with the colors. I’m always looking for a good neutral nude beige gloss color (they are surprisingly difficult to find) and I discovered more than one. Pictured from left to right: Lip Attitude Star in Funky Beige, Rouge Cream Lipsticks in Mr. Lover and 1st Night, and Lip Attitude Glamour in Brown Illusion, which would be a perfect neutral on a deeper toned skin. All products, including this one, should be spot tested for sensitivities. Available at Sephora. A very reasonable $12.

Leonor Greyl Huile De Magnolia

A few days ago the people at Leonor Greyl sent over some products for me to try. I’m still working through them, but I instantly fell in love with this rich, decadently scented, multi-purpose oil. According to the “directions for use” on the back of the bottle, the product can be used on face and body for after-sun, to soothe after hair removal, or as a makeup remover and facial oil. When I first inhaled it’s delicious scent, I immediately pictured myself walking the beach at dusk on an exotic equatorial island, skin tanned and glowing, a white flower in my slicked back hair. Yes, its that amazing. A tiny bit leaves your skin silky-smooth, and the scent lasts for hours. All products, including this one, should be spot tested for sensitivities. $47.
